Wisdom of the Ojibwe: Healing from Grief Through Shared Traditions (In-person)

  • Walker High School Walker, MN United States (map)

Join Dr. Anton Treuer for an insightful conversation on Ojibwe teachings about navigating loss and finding healing. Drawing from time-honored traditions, Dr. Treuer highlights universal values of family, community, and resilience. This talk offers practical perspectives on grieving—inviting people of all backgrounds to discover hope, meaning, and strength in the face of life’s hardest moments.

This talk is part of the RALLY Coalition gathering in Walker, MN and repeats from 2:00-3:00pm.
